Vogue magazine from 1965 aimed to portray an aspirational lifestyle focused on fashion, beauty, and wealth. It featured glamorous advertisements and models that promoted stereotypical notions of femininity. While some readers may have been entertained or used the magazine to develop their identity, others likely saw the narrow representations as unrealistic or oppressive. As a large publisher, Conde Nast had significant power in the industry to influence audiences and minimize competition.
The Big Issue from 2017 featured diverse representations of its vendors moving past homelessness. Through positive portrayals, it aimed to cultivate empathy from readers and challenge prejudices by presenting homelessness as a temporary experience overcome through hard work.
